Samantha’s new movie Yashoda is an extension to this. It is creating records in the pre-release business. According to sources, Yashoda has been sold for more than 50 crores. Digital rights were taken for 24 crores in exchange, satellite rights were sold for 13 crores, overseas theatricals got 2.5 crores.

Telugu state’s theatrical business is sold for 11 crores. In other languages, the production house is releasing the film on its own.
